Job summary

MCI is seeking a Customer Service Representative for its Midway, Georgia location. The role involves engaging with customers through inbound calls to resolve issues and enhance their experience. Candidates should possess strong communication skills and thrive in a fast-paced environment.

Successful applicants will receive training, comprehensive health benefits, and participate in incentive programs, alongside opportunities for career growth.

Position Overview

MCI is one of the fastest-growing tech-enabled business services companies in the USA, with a strong call center footprint and operations that extend across multiple countries. We deliver Customer Experience (CX), Business Process Outsourcing (BPO), and Anything-as-a-Service (XaaS) cloud technology solutions across a wide range of industries, including healthcare, retail, government, education, telecom, technology e‑commerce, and financial services. Our contact centers are powered by both on‑site and remote agents, leveraging advanced technologies to enhance customer journeys, drive scalability and reduce costs.

At MCI we are committed to fostering an environment where professionals can build meaningful careers, access continuous learning and development opportunities and contribute to the success of a globally expanding, industry‑leading organization.

Key Responsibilities
  • Engage with customers via inbound calls to understand and resolve their concerns.
  • Use internal systems and tools to manage accounts and process requests.
  • Identify opportunities to upsell or upgrade services using consultative sales techniques.
  • Clearly explain products, services, and procedures to customers.
  • Escalate unresolved or complex issues to the appropriate team or manager.
  • Ensure first‑call resolution through effective communication and problem‑solving.
Candidate Qualifications
  • Must be 18 years or older with a high school diploma or equivalent.
  • Strong written and verbal communication skills.
  • Ability to type 20+ words per minute accurately.
  • Basic proficiency in Microsoft Office Suite (Word, Excel, Outlook, PowerPoint).
  • Familiarity with Windows operating systems.
  • Dependable and punctual with a strong work ethic.
  • Skilled in troubleshooting, conflict resolution, and customer follow‑up.
  • A customer‑first mindset: empathetic, patient, and responsive.
  • Ability to multi‑task, stay organized, and work independently.
  • Thrive in a fast‑paced, team‑oriented environment.
  • Excellent interpersonal skills and a collaborative spirit.
Conditions of Employment
  • Must be authorized to work in the country where the job is based.
  • Must be willing to submit up to a LEVEL II background and/or security investigation with a fingerprint. Job offers are contingent on background/security investigation results.
  • Must be willing to submit to drug screening. Job offers are contingent on drug screening results.

Physical Requirements

This job operates in a professional office environment. While performing the duties of this job, the employee will be largely sedentary and will be required to sit/stand for long periods while using a computer and telephone headset. The employee will be regularly required to operate a computer and other office equipment, including a phone, copier, and printer. The employee may occasionally be required to move about the office to accomplish tasks; reach in any direction; raise or lower objects, move objects from place to place, hold onto objects, and move or exert force up to forty (40) pounds.
